UOI :
Transdisciplinary theme: Where we are in place and time.
Central idea: Homes reflect cultural influences and local conditions.
- Field Trip to visit mud houses and Sheri houses.
- Story: “The three little pigs”
- Classroom discussion about the different materials used to build a house.
Transdisciplinary theme: How we express ourselves
Central idea: Celebrations and traditions are expressions of shared beliefs and values.
- Ganesh Chaturthi Celebration: Significance and story was catered.

Language:
- Revision of previously taught letter sounds ( c, k, e, h, r, m, d, g, o, u, l, f, b) and blends br, cr, gr, fr, dr, pr, tr, bl, cl, fl, gl dl, pl, tl.
- Introduction of digraph /oa/ and /ie/ through a story
- /oa/ and /ie/ – song and action
- Blending and segmenting of /oa/ and /ie/ words
- Dictation of /oa/ and /ie/ words on slate.
- Jolly Phonics Pupil Book 1- Pg No. 22 and 23
- Word list:
/oa/ words |
/ie/ words |
oak, oats, goal, float, load, loaf, soap, coast, road, soak, goat, coat, boat, moan. |
pie, die, lie, untie, cries, fries, flies, fried, dried, spied, tried, tie. |
